在数字化的浪潮中,大型语言模型(Large Language Model,简称LLM)如GPT-3、LaMDA等,已经成为了人工智能领域的明星。它们凭借强大的语言理解和生成能力,为各行各业带来了颠覆性的变革。本文将深入探讨大模型背后的科技力量,以及它们在未来的潜在应用。
大模型的科技力量
1. 数据驱动
大模型的核心在于其庞大的数据集。这些数据集通常包含数十亿甚至数千亿个文本片段,覆盖了从新闻报道到社交媒体帖子等各种类型的内容。通过深度学习算法,模型可以从这些数据中学习语言的规律和结构。
# 示例:使用PyTorch构建一个简单的语言模型
import torch
import torch.nn as nn
class LanguageModel(nn.Module):
def __init__(self, vocab_size, embedding_dim, hidden_dim):
super(LanguageModel, self).__init__()
self.embedding = nn.Embedding(vocab_size, embedding_dim)
self.rnn = nn.GRU(embedding_dim, hidden_dim)
self.fc = nn.Linear(hidden_dim, vocab_size)
def forward(self, x):
embedded = self.embedding(x)
output, hidden = self.rnn(embedded)
return self.fc(hidden[-1])
2. 深度学习
深度学习是构建大模型的关键技术。通过多层神经网络,模型能够捕捉到语言数据的复杂特征。在训练过程中,模型不断调整参数,以最小化预测误差。
3. 自适应优化
大模型通常采用自适应优化算法,如Adam或RMSprop,这些算法能够有效地调整学习率,加快训练速度。
大模型的应用前景
1. 自动内容生成
大模型在自动内容生成领域有着广泛的应用,包括新闻报道、诗歌创作、小说撰写等。
2. 聊天机器人
大模型可以用于构建智能聊天机器人,提供个性化服务,如客户支持、情感咨询等。
3. 机器翻译
大模型在机器翻译领域的表现已经超越了传统的基于规则的方法,能够提供更加流畅和准确的翻译结果。
4. 医疗诊断
在医疗领域,大模型可以辅助医生进行诊断,通过分析病历和病例报告,提高诊断的准确性。
5. 教育辅助
大模型可以用于个性化教育,根据学生的学习情况提供定制化的学习材料和辅导。
总结
大模型作为人工智能领域的一项重要技术,正逐渐改变着我们的生活和工作方式。随着技术的不断进步,我们有理由相信,大模型将在未来的各个领域发挥更加重要的作用。